#f9e7a8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9e7a8 is composed of 97.6% red, 90.6%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 32.5%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 46.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 81.8%. #f9e7a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f3cf51.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

● #f9e7a8 color description : Very soft yellow.
#f9e7a8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9e7a8 has RGB values of R:249, G:231,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.33,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16377768.
